Key Features

Microsoft Copilot embeds seamlessly into tools like Word, Excel, Teams, and Edge, offering contextual assistance. Leveraging OpenAI's technology and Bing's search capabilities, it delivers reliable answers and task automation. Its knowledge base is strong on web-sourced data and productivity-related content, with lightning-fast response times thanks to Microsoft's robust infrastructure.

It offers a generous free tier, with a premium Copilot Pro version unlocking advanced features for individual users, and deeper integration available through Microsoft 365 subscriptions.

Pricing

Microsoft Copilot is free to use in its basic form, accessible via the web or Microsoft apps. Copilot Pro costs $20/month, offering enhanced features like priority access and deeper app integration. For businesses, it's bundled into Microsoft 365 plans (e.g., $30/user/month), adding significant value for enterprise users.

What Is Microsoft Copilot?

Microsoft Copilot is an AI assistant integrated into Microsoft's suite of tools, designed to enhance productivity using OpenAI tech and Bing search.

How Does Microsoft Copilot Work?

It combines natural language processing with real-time web data and Microsoft app integration to assist with tasks like writing, data analysis, and more.

Is Microsoft Copilot Accurate?

Yes, it's reliable for productivity tasks and web info, though it may lack depth in creative or niche conversational areas.

Is Microsoft Copilot Free?

Yes, it offers a free tier. Copilot Pro costs $20/month, and enterprise features are part of Microsoft 365 subscriptions.

How Does Microsoft Copilot Compare to Other AI Services?

It excels in productivity and speed within Microsoft's ecosystem, but it's less versatile for general-purpose use compared to some competitors.
